Effects of fitness exercise on Aerobic capacity, Anaerobic capacity, Muscular fitness, Flexibility, Grip strength, Static balance and social behavior in children with autism spectrum disorders.

Conditions

Health Condition 1: F840- Autistic disorder

Interventions

Intervention1: Fitness exercise: Grab Ball Complex (GBC) Ball Tap Complex (BTC) Hurdle Step-overs Bear Crawls Med ball/Sandbell overhead throws and slams Scramble Resistance Band Rotations Star Jumps

Eligibility

Inclusion criteria

Inclusion criteria: Child with 1 and 2 levels of autism severity based on GARS-2 Child should be able to perform the requested exercise interventions

Exclusion criteria

Exclusion criteria: Child with any other complex neurologic disorder (e.g. epilepsy, phenylketonuria, fragile X syndrome, and tuberous sclerosis).

Design outcomes

Primary

MeasureTime frame
six minute walk test muscle power sprint test long jump test sit and reach test hand grip static balance social behaviorTimepoint: at baseline & post intervention (5 week & 10 week)

Secondary

MeasureTime frame
height weight BMITimepoint: at baseline & post-intervention (5 week & 10 week)
